Position Title: Commercial & Residential Property SolicitorLocation: East London/ Essex borderSalary: £50,000 - £55,000 open for discussionReference: Work Type: Full time, PermanentLegal 500 law firm located on the East London and Essex border are currently seeking to recruit a Property Solicitor from 2 years PQE to join their team.Our Client is seeking a qualified and motivated Property Solicitor with a minimum of 2 years PQE to join their team. The successful applicant will manage a diverse caseload of commercial property matters and some residential property matters and be expected to deliver high-quality legal services in property-related transactions.Key Responsibilities:
  • Manage a full caseload of commercial property matters, including freehold and leasehold transactions, secured lending, and development projects.
  • Act for a range of clients and handle business sales and purchases.
  • Ensure compliance with relevant property law regulations while maintaining a high standard of client care.
  • Build and maintain strong relationships with clients, financial institutions, and other stakeholders.
  • Contribute proactively to the growth and success of the property department.
Requirements:
  • A minimum of 2 yearsĀ PQE as a qualified Solicitor, with a strong background in commercial property law and some residential property.
  • IT literacy and excellent analytical, communication, and negotiation skills.
  • Ability to manage own caseload independently, meeting deadlines and targets.
  • Some experience within residential conveyancing is desirable.
  • A positive, proactive, and professional approach, with confidence, commercial awareness, and problem-solving skills.
